Austria has so much to offer and is a wonderful destination. Most of the west of the country is dominated by the Alps, where you will find traditional alpine villages with romantic chalets through to the larger winter ski resorts. And when there is no snow, the magnificent flower covered mountains provide some of the most fantastic hiking and mountain biking routes around.

Vienna and the other larger cities are home to several very famous museums and private art collections. The capital is Austria's main centre for music and its history and grandeur is reflected in its highly impressive architecture. Salzburg, Mozart's birthplace is also a wonderful and romantic city and like Vienna has some fabulous Baroque architecture, while Innsbruck nestles into the snow-capped mountains and has more of an alpine feel.

Much of Austria has an old fashioned atmosphere where people enjoy the simple pleasures of life like cycling along the Wachau stretch of the Danube River, past castles and vineyards or hiking through alpine scenery. Taking the cable car from Salzburg to the castle above and then walking down the hill with the city laid out in front of you is a memorable experience and there are charming restaurants where you can stop off for their famous wiener schnitzel.

An example of this is Schloss Kogl, built in 1750 and only a short drive from Salzburg and just two hours from Vienna. The surrounding area is part of the 'Salzkammergut' which is famous for its many beautiful lakes, including the Attersee, the largest in Austria. This wonderful location offers swimming, fishing, surfing, sailing and hiking, and hunting expeditions can be arranged.
